Chris
re-signed for his third spell with
Rugby in November
2015 after over five years with Bedworth United.
Tullin
was originally snapped
up by then-Valley
manager Billy Jeffrey
in 2005 when he
became surplus to
requirements at
Nuneaton Borough
having spent four
years in the fringes
of the first team
at Manor Park.
Renowned
as a versatile and
energetic player,
Chris can operate
anywhere across
defence or midfield.
After
leaving Butlin Road
at the end of the
2006/7 season, Tullin
has played for Atherstone
Town and Shepshed
Dynamo.
He then re-joined Valley for a second spell in the November 2009 but he could not turn the fortunes around as the club were relegated from the Southern League Premier Division.
In June 2010 Tullin
left for Bedworth United where he played for five seasons which included two promotion campaigns from the Southern League Division One before re-joining Rugby.
Tullin featured in almost every game once he returned in the heart of defence before leaving the club at the end of the season. |
